"Hi, guys. We're here showing you guys how to do some improv warm-ups, and today we're going to show you the dance-based warm-up, called "Down." To play "Down," you're going to have your group assembled in a large circle, and you're going to take turns--or, collectively as a group, you're going to sing this song. And it goes like so: D-O-W-N. That's the way we get down. Uh-huh. D-O-W-N. That's the way we get down. Uh-huh. At what point in time--at that point in time then, whoever in the circle has the focus is going to ask another person this following sequence of interactions: Hey, Daniel. Hey, what? Hey, Daniel. And the energy just gets passed around the circle, like so. Everyone dances and has a good time, gets loosened up. And that's how you play "Down.""
